Ocean current energy, also known as ocean tidal energy, is a type of renewable energy that harnesses the power of ocean currents and tides to generate electricity. Unlike traditional wind and solar power, ocean current energy is a constant and reliable source of energy, making it an attractive solution for meeting our growing energy demands.

One of the most promising technologies in this field is the tidal stream generator, which uses underwater turbines to tap into the kinetic energy of ocean currents. These turbines are designed to rotate as the current flows past them, generating electricity that can be fed into the grid. The advantage of tidal stream generators is that they can operate in areas with very high tidal ranges, making them ideal for coastal regions with significant tidal activity.

Despite the promise of ocean current energy, there are still significant challenges to overcome before it can become a mainstream source of power. One of the biggest hurdles is the high upfront cost of installing and maintaining the infrastructure required to harness ocean currents. However, as the technology continues to advance and economies of scale improve, the cost of ocean current energy is expected to come down dramatically.

In addition to its potential to reduce our reliance on fossil fuels, ocean current energy also offers numerous environmental benefits. Unlike traditional fossil fuels, ocean current energy produces no greenhouse gas emissions or other pollutants, making it a much cleaner source of power.
